About this listen
Jack Ryan, Jr. is on a path that leads to international destruction.
The quiet of a Texas night is shattered by the sounds of screeching brakes, crumpling metal and, most shockingly, rapid gunfire. The auto accident Jack Ryan, Jr. thought he witnessed turned out to be a professional hit. Jack may be too late to save the victim, but he'll be damned if he's going to let the hitters escape justice.
He's got just one lead - a meeting the victim was going to. When Jack shows up instead, he's drawn into the seedy underbelly of a small Texas town and the cold case of a college student who vanished from its streets.
Jack is left with nothing but questions. Who wants it to look like the victim was drunk? Why does someone want an innocent witness killed? And most of all, what's a team of South African hitmen doing in the Lone Star State?
His quest for answers will take Jack from a quiet Texas road to the middle of an international conspiracy - and may just cost him his life.

Plot Overview
The story revolves around a covert team tasked with investigating and dismantling a secret operation that aims to develop and distribute advanced weaponry capable of destabilizing global power structures. From the deserts of the Middle East to the laboratories of Eastern Europe, the narrative takes readers on a journey filled with espionage, betrayal, and explosive confrontations.
Strengths:
Thrilling Action: The action scenes are cinematic, with firefights, stealth missions, and high-stakes chases keeping the pace brisk and engaging.
Intricate Plot: The narrative weaves together multiple threads—political intrigue, technological innovation, and moral dilemmas—creating a rich and compelling story.
Attention to Detail: The depiction of advanced weaponry and military tactics is meticulously researched, lending credibility to the high-tech scenarios.
Timely Themes: The story explores contemporary issues like the black market for military tech and the ethics of weapon development, adding depth and relevance.
Weaknesses:
Character Development: While the plot is strong, some characters feel underdeveloped, serving more as vehicles for the story rather than fully realized individuals.
Predictability: Certain twists and outcomes may feel familiar to seasoned readers of the genre, though the execution remains engaging.
Overall Impression:
Weapons Grade delivers exactly what fans of Tom Clancy have come to expect: a tense, action-packed narrative grounded in realism and global stakes. While it doesn’t break new ground, it successfully upholds the franchise’s legacy of intelligent and thrilling storytelling.
